Feature Detectors
Nerve cells in the brain that respond to specific features of a stimulus, such as shape, angle, or movement.
Absolute Threshold
The minimum stimulus intensity required to detect a particular stimulus 50% of the time.
Adaptation Threshold
The limit to which an organism or a system can adapt to changes in conditions or stimuli.
Difference Threshold
The smallest amount of change in a stimulus that can be detected as different from the original stimulus.
